12th August 1922 – Birmingham News

Sunday Music in the Park – In spite of the rain Kings Heath Prize band were able to go through the afternoon performance of music in Kings heath park, but the evening concert had eventually to be abandoned.

Scripture and Horticulture – The second of a series of lecture-addresses on gardening in relation to the Scriptures was given by Mr. J. Smith, F.R.H.S., of Kings Heath Park, to the members of the Kings Heath Baptist P.S.A. on Sunday afternoon. Mr. Smith indicated how wonderfully the Scriptures applied to modern horticulture, and reminded his hearers of many ways in which the truth of Holy Writ was established in the ways of horticulture. Specially appropriate hymns were sung. Mr. J.S. May presided. The next lecture takes place some time in December.
